In Oregon, H-1B/LCA filings disclose a median tech base wage of around US$144,690 a year. Here's the disclosed pay range and how it breaks down by role.
Disclosed base wage
The median disclosed base wage is US$144,690 a year, with most filings between US$119,288 and US$170,040.
| 25th percentile | US$119,288 |
|---|---|
| Median (50th percentile) | US$144,690 |
| 75th percentile | US$170,040 |
Disclosed base wage, from 885 H-1B/LCA filings, U.S. DOL OFLC, as of June 2026.
This is the base wage employers attest on H-1B/LCA filings to meet the prevailing wage — it leaves out equity and bonus and reflects visa-sponsored hires, so it runs lower than total compensation. Read it alongside the advertised salary on each role page.
Disclosed pay by role
| Role | Median base wage | Filings |
|---|---|---|
| Software Engineer | US$148,929 | 674 |
| Data Engineer | US$130,450 | 48 |
| QA Engineer | US$112,037 | 41 |
| Engineering Manager | US$180,884 | 31 |
| Data Scientist | US$134,018 | 30 |
| DevOps Engineer | US$98,952 | 30 |
| Security Engineer | US$117,624 | 9 |
| Frontend Engineer | US$113,188 | 8 |
Disclosed wage data from the U.S. Department of Labor, OFLC.
